Common Last Names Beginning with Z
When faced with the initial “Z” for Joseph’s last name, it’s useful to explore common surnames that start with this letter. These names often have distinct origins and cultural ties that can give clues about Joseph’s background.
The letter Z is less common for surnames in many Western cultures, but it appears frequently in others. For example, many surnames beginning with Z have roots in Eastern Europe, the Middle East, or Latin America.
This diversity offers an interesting range of possibilities for Joseph Z’s surname.
Knowing popular last names starting with Z can narrow down the search or at least provide a starting point for further investigation.
| Last Name | Origin | Meaning |
| Zhang | Chinese | To open up, spread |
| Zamora | Spanish | From a city in Spain |
| Zimmerman | German | Carpenter |
| Zayas | Spanish | Derived from a place name |

Famous Individuals Named Joseph Z
One way to uncover what Joseph Z’s last name might be is by looking at notable figures who share this name pattern. Famous Josephs with a last name starting with Z can serve as references or points of comparison.
While many famous Josephs exist, a few carry the initial Z prominently, linking it to their full surnames. Identifying these individuals helps to understand the variety and prominence of certain last names.
These examples also demonstrate how a last name contributes to personal branding and public recognition, making it an essential aspect of identity.
- Joseph Zedner: A 19th-century German bibliographer known for his work on Hebrew literature.
- Joseph Zawinul: An influential Austrian-American jazz keyboardist and composer.
- Joseph Zych: A Polish politician who served as Speaker of the Sejm.

Legal and Social Implications of Last Names
Last names carry legal weight in many countries, used in official documents, identification, and inheritance rights. Knowing Joseph Z’s full surname is crucial for legal clarity and social recognition.
Socially, a last name can influence perceptions, opportunities, and interactions. It can also affect group identity and belonging, which underscores why many seek to know the full names behind initials.
In some cases, changing or abbreviating a last name can have significant consequences, including challenges in legal matters or social acceptance.
- Legal Identity: Required for passports, licenses, and contracts.
- Inheritance and Property: Last names link to family estates and rights.
- Social Perception: Names can affect first impressions and biases.
Comparing Legal Uses of Last Names Globally
| Country | Legal Use of Last Name | Notes |
| United States | Mandatory on all legal documents | Commonly passed through paternal lineage |
| Japan | Used formally; married couples often share surname | Changing surname requires legal process |
| Brazil | Multiple surnames common; include both parents’ names | Flexibility in order and choice |
